Transaction 2f77532cd95506e868db4e4aeb91cbd33eb311ef4a7b94674a81492b9b30e325
1 Input
1 Output
-
2f77532cd95506e868db4e4aeb91cbd33eb311ef4a7b94674a81492b9b30e325:0
- value
- 21099
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3c740e2ff9c8e9d1738e745361322eb6458dc05
- address
- bc1q60r5pchlnj8f69ecuaznvyezadj93hq9jh6xar